
STREETFIGHTER v4

Technical Specification Engine |
|
---|---|
Type | Desmosedici Stradale 90° V4, rearward-rotating crankshaft, 4 Desmodromically actuated valves per cylinder, liquid cooled. |
Displacement | 1,103 cc |
Bore x Stroke | 81 x 53.5 mm |
Compression ratio | 14.0:1 |
Power | 153 kW (208 hp) @ 13,000 rpm / 153 kW (208 hp) @ 12,750 rpm* |
Torque | 123 Nm (90.4 lb-ft) @ 11,500 rpm / 123 Nm (90.4 lb-ft) @ 9,500 rpm* |
Fuel injection | Electronic fuel injection system. Twin injectors per cylinder. Full ride-by-wire elliptical throttle bodies. |
Exhaust | 4-2-1-2 system, with 2 catalytic converters and 4 lambda probes |
Transmission |
|
Gearbox | 6 speed with Ducati Quick Shift (DQS) up/down EVO 2 |
Primary drive | Straight cut gears; Ratio 1.80:1 |
Ratio | 1=38/14 2=36/17 3=33/19 4=32/21 5=30/22 6=30/24 |
Final drive | Chain; Front sprocket 15; Rear sprocket 42 |
Clutch | Hydraulically controlled slipper and self-servo wet multiplate clutch. Self bleeding master cylinder |
Chassis |
|
Frame | Aluminum alloy “Front Frame” |
Front suspension | Fully adjustable Showa BPF fork. 43 mm chromed inner tubes |
Front wheel | 5-spokes light alloy 3.50″ x 17″ |
Front Tyre | Pirelli Diablo Supercorsa SP 120/70 ZR17 |
Rear suspension | Fully adjustable Sachs unit. Aluminum single-sided swingarm. |
Rear wheel | 5-split spoke carbon fiber 6.00″ x 17″ |
Rear tyre | Pirelli Diablo Supercorsa SP 200/60 ZR17 |
Front wheel travel | 120 mm (4.7 in) – 130 mm (5.1 in) |
Rear wheel travel | 120 mm (4.7 in) – 130 mm (5.1 in) |
Front brake | 2 x 330 mm semi-floating discs, radially mounted Brembo Monobloc Stylema® (M4.30) 4-piston callipers with Cornering ABS EVO. Self bleeding master cylinder |
Rear brake | 245 mm disc, 2-piston calliper with Bosch Cornering ABS EVO |
Instrumentation | Last generation digital unit with 5″ TFT colour display |
Dimensions and weight |
|
Dry weight |
180 kg (397 lb)
Weight data refers to the dry weight of the motorcycle without battery, lubricants and coolants for liquid-cooled models.
|
Wet weight (KERB) |
201 kg (443 lb)
Kerb weights indicate total bike weight with all operating consumable liquids and a fuel tank filled to 90% of capacity (as per EC standard 93/93).
|
Seat height | 845 mm (33.3 in) |
Wheelbase | 1.488 mm (58.6 in) |
Rake | 24,5° |
Trail | 100 mm (4 in) |
Fuel tank capacity | 16 l – 4.23 gallon (US) |
Number of seats | Dual seat |
